The Significance of a Poker Face:

A poker face is more than a blank expression; it's a shield that guards your thoughts and emotions from prying eyes. The ability to maintain a neutral demeanor under pressure is crucial in poker, where players aim to decipher each other's intentions. A well-maintained poker face keeps opponents guessing, making it challenging for them to read your moves and react accordingly.

 

Tips to Develop an Impenetrable Poker Face:

 

Practice in Front of a Mirror:

Spend time practicing your poker face in front of a mirror. This allows you to observe your expressions and make adjustments to maintain a neutral and unreadable countenance.

 

Control Your Breathing:

Deep, steady breaths help in managing stress and anxiety, two emotions that can easily betray your intentions. Focus on controlling your breathing to maintain composure during crucial moments.

 

Master the Art of Stillness:

A poker face requires minimal facial movement. Train yourself to minimize gestures, such as blinking, fidgeting, or twitching, which can inadvertently reveal information about your hand.

 

Observe Professional Players:

Watch professional poker players in action. Analyze how they maintain their composure and observe the subtle cues they give off. Incorporate these insights into your own approach.

 

Play Mind Games:

Use the poker face as a tool to play mind games with opponents. Convey false information through controlled expressions to mislead others about the strength or weakness of your hand.

 

How a Mastered Poker Face Can Transform Your Game:

 

Confuse Opponents:

A well-maintained poker face leaves opponents uncertain about the strength of your hand. This confusion can lead them to make mistakes, providing you with a strategic advantage.

 

Enhance Bluffing Skills:

Bluffing is a fundamental aspect of poker, and a convincing poker face is crucial for successful bluffing. Mastering the art of the poker face enables you to bluff more effectively and with greater success.

 

Maintain Emotional Control:

Poker is a game of highs and lows. A controlled poker face helps you manage your emotions, preventing opponents from exploiting your reactions and capitalizing on your emotional state.
